RAYNAL, Guillaume Thomas Francois (1713-1796). Histoire philosophique et politique des etablissemens & du commerce des Europeens dans les deux Indes. Geneva: Jean-Leonard Pellet, 1780.
5 volumes, 4o (255 x 195 mm). Engraved portrait, 4 engraved plates, 50 engraved double-page maps, and 23 folding tables (a few maps with blank portion cut from margin). Contemporary green morocco gilt, flat spine with glit lettered red morocco label and 7 gilt decorated red morocco bands (minor wear to some spine ends, spines evenly faded).
Later edition. A large portion of this work is said to have been written by Diderot, and others. "The book was condemned by the French parliament and church dignitaries, and Raynal was obliged to leave France" (Sabin). Cohen de Ricci 854; Sabin 68081. (3)
